Free energy analysis for a system of interacting particles arranged in Bravais lattice | B. I. Lev
; V. B. Tymchyshyn
; A. G. Zagorodny
; | Date: |
3 May 2015 | Abstract: | We propose a method of free energy calculation for a system of interacting
particles arranged in a Bravais lattice. It will be shown how to treat
divergences for infinite unbounded systems with "catastrophic" potetntials like
Coulomb and compare two of them. Besides, we show that current method may be
used not only for essentially classical systems, but for some quantum as well.
Two systems are considered: grains in dusty plasma and electrons on the
liquid-helium surface. For dusty-plasma parameters of grain’s lattice are
calculated by numerical solution of obtained equations. Electrons on the
liquid-helium surface are analyzed to get localization distance. Besides,
conditions for existence of electron lattice are found. | Source: | arXiv, 1505.0408 | Services: | Forum | Review | PDF | Favorites |
